Cotton Daisies // Digital Download

$11.00

THE PRIMARY PHOTO OF COTTON DAISIES WAS TAKEN BY RENEE NANNEMAN OF NEED'l LOVE.

The fabrics used in the primary photo are from Renee's fabric line called Beehive. It is no longer in print, but this quilt can easily be recreated using similar light shades of cream for the flower petals. Slight variation or contrast in the petal colors create a nice blending. If there is too much contrast, the petals loose their soft shading. The quilting on the primary photo is all free hand custom quilting by Sue Pardon

Cotton Daisies is an easy quilt to make using simple traditional piecing methods.

The pattern includes 3 sizes.: Wall Hanging, Lap Quilt and Queen Size. Looking for a King size? Scroll down until you find all the sizes, fabric requirements for each including backing.

The wide 3" binding gives Cotton Daisies a nice finish for the smaller wall hanging or add a flange to the larger lap size quilt.

Imagine this pattern using blues for Bachelor Buttons, or Black and Golds to create Black-eyed Susan's!
Even reds or pinks for Poinsettias! Oh the possibilities!
